• Head First HTML之布局


    漂移布局

    漂移布局是指使用float对元素向左或向右浮动,在浮动元素的下方的元素,可以使用clear对其样式进行清理,避免被浮动元素覆盖。

    问题:放置顺序会发生变化导致浏览器阅读顺序发生变化。

    冻结布局

    冻结布局,固定所有内容大小。

    问题:内容不会随浏览器窗口的变化而扩展。

    凝胶物布局

    固定所有内容大小,通过auto属性让边界扩展成凝胶物布局,并把内容放在页面中间。

    绝对布局

    创建流动布局,使用absolute属性定位元素,可以吧元素放在页面的任何位置。会占用一定的页面空间。可以用z-index调整叠放位置,z-index值越大,相对用户的位置就越近。

    问题:绝对元素不能使用clear属性,当浏览器变宽时,会覆盖其他元素内容。

    相对布置

    属于页面流中的一部分。相对布置可以使元素仍然在流中,留出元素需要的空间,并把它偏移到它实际要显示的地方。

    固定布置

    总是以相对于浏览器窗口的位置放置,页面滚动式不会发生移动。页面其他内容在固定布置的元素下移动。

  • 相关阅读:
    leetcode 之Jump Game
    leetcode 之 Symmetric Tree
    leetcode 之 House Robber
    设计模式之建造者模式
    centos7 yum tab 补全
    设计模式之适配器模式
    设计模式之状态模式
    设计模式之外观模式
    设计模式之模板方法模式
    对以<uses-permission android:maxSdkVersion="xx" /> 中的说明
  • 原文地址:https://www.cnblogs.com/zoeyll/p/4449522.html
Copyright © 2020-2023  润新知